分散式檔案儲存系統技術及實現
本課程針對分步式檔案儲存系統的實現進行講解,首先分析為什麼要使用這種分步式儲存系統,以及這種系統在設計時需要注意的問題,並比較現在市面常見的分步式儲存系統(HDFS、Ceph等),展示阿里Pangu系統針對其中問題的解決方法,並結合Pangu系統說明分步式儲存系統的設計要點。
開始學習:分散式檔案儲存系統技術及實現
講師介紹
姚文輝,2009年加入阿里巴巴,從事阿里巴巴自主研發的雲端計算平臺—飛天分散式作業系統中的分散式儲存系統—盤古。
課時列表:
課時1:分散式儲存客觀需求
課時2:小概率事件對分散式系統的挑戰
課時3:常見分散式系統-終版
課時4:分散式設計要點
課時5:分散式系統功能設計--寫入流程
課時6:分散式系統功能設計--讀取流程
課時7:分散式系統功能設計-QoS
課時8:分散式系統功能設計-Checksum
課時9:分散式系統功能設計-Replication
課時10:分散式系統功能設計-Rebalance
課時11:分散式系統功能設計-GC
課時12:分散式系統功能設計-Erasure Coding
課時13:元資料管理的高可用性
課時14:元資料管理的可擴充套件性
課時15:資料混合儲存
更多精品課程點選:阿里雲大學
相關推薦
分散式檔案儲存系統技術及實現
本課程針對分步式檔案儲存系統的實現進行講解,首先分析為什麼要使用這種分步式儲存系統,以及這種系統在設計時需要注意的問題,並比較現在市面常見的分步式儲存系統(HDFS、Ceph等),展示阿里Pangu系統針對其中問題的解決方法,並結合Pangu系統說明分步式儲存系統的設計要點。 開始學習:分散式檔
深入淺出分散式檔案儲存系統之 Ceph 的實現
一、何為分散式檔案檔案系統 分散式檔案系統(Distributed File System)是指檔案系統管理的物理儲存資源不一定直接連線在本地節點上,而是通過計算機網路與節點相連,它的設計是基於客戶端/伺服器模式。 &n
HDFS(分散式檔案儲存系統)
一 、HDFS命令列客戶端的常用操作命令 (1)start-dfs.sh :自動啟動整個叢集 stop-dfs.sh :自動停止整個叢集 (2)上傳檔案到hdfs中: hadoop fs -pu
搭建FastDFS分散式檔案儲存系統教程
轉載來源:https://github.com/happyfish100/fastdfs/wiki 搭建FastDFS分散式檔案儲存系統教程 環境準備 使用的系統軟體 名稱 說明
基於記憶體的分散式檔案儲存系統Alluxio
如果是隻有欄位快取的話,redis應該是夠用了。但是如果涉及到大量檔案,尤其是用hdfs作為底層儲存結構的,建議用alluxio升級一下。一方面有利於spark資源控制,另一方面也可以統一入口便於擴充套件。 1 叢集規劃 三臺伺服器hadoop-ma
創業公司如何構建一個分散式檔案儲存系統
有時候初創企業需要快速搭建一個檔案儲存平臺,滿足企業內專案的圖片、視訊、文字等檔案的儲存;並且即使在讀寫檔案的時候,磁碟壞了、伺服器宕機了、交換機壞了、機櫃掉電了甚至機房掛了,使用者還能正常訪問。你同時可能希望公司業務快速增長後,訪問量猛增的時候能夠儘量少的或者不開發程式碼
Hadoop 三劍客之 —— 分散式檔案儲存系統 HDFS
一、介紹 二、HDFS 設計原理 2.1 HDFS 架構 2.2 檔案系統名稱空間 2.3 資料複製 2.4 資料複製的實現原理 2.5 副本的選擇 2.6 架構的穩定性 三、HDFS 的特點 附:圖解HDFS儲存原理 1. HDFS寫資料原理
必須掌握的分散式檔案儲存系統—HDFS
HDFS(Hadoop Distributed File System)分散式檔案儲存系統,主要為各類分散式計算框架如Spark、MapReduce等提供海量資料儲存服務,同時HBase、Hive底層儲存也依賴於HDFS。HDFS提供一個統一的抽象目錄樹,客戶端可通過路徑來訪問檔案,如hdfs://namen
文獻綜述六:基於JS 技術的電子商品管理系統設計及實現
一、基本資訊 標題:基於JS 技術的電子商品管理系統設計及實現 時間:2017 出版源:無線互聯科技 檔案分類:js技術的研究 二、研究背景 主要對Js下電商管理系統的設計及實現進行了探討,利用軟體工程的設計方法和先進的軟體開發框架來實現電子商務管理。 三、具體內容 開頭提到了什麼是j
Kubernetes儲存系統介紹及機制實現
一、Kubernetes中儲存的應用場景 在Kubernetes中部署和執行的服務大致分為: 1. 無狀態服務 Kubernetes使用ReplicaSet來保證一個服務的例項數量,如果說某個Pod例項由於某種原因掛掉或崩潰,ReplicaSet會立刻用這個Pod的模版
HDFS二.HDFS實現分散式檔案儲存---體系結構
單擊模式(Standalone): 單機模式是Hadoop的預設模式。當首次解壓Hadoop的原始碼包時,Hadoop無法瞭解硬體安裝環境,便保守地選擇了最小配置。在這種預設模式下所有3個XML檔案均為空。當配置檔案為空時,Hadoop會完全執行在本地。因為不需要與其他節點互動,單機模式就不使用HDFS,也
Kubernetes儲存系統介紹及機制實現_Kubernetes中文社群
【編者的話】本次分享分為三大部分。第一部分主要介紹Kubernetes中常用的幾種儲存,及其使用場景和生命週期等等。第二部分試圖介紹一些設計原則和基本架構,並簡要介紹各種儲存plugin的實現機制及持久卷的一些特性,例如訪問模式、回收策略等等。動態卷供給是一個Kubernetes獨有的功能,這
Hadoop檔案儲存系統-HDFS詳解以及java程式設計實現
前言 這是關於Hadoop的系列文章。 背景 我們在本系列的第一篇文章的時候就談到過,面對海量資料,我們最為缺乏的就是對大資料量的儲存能力以及處理能力。而這兩種能力在Hadoop的體現分別就是HDFS以及map-redu
EJB2.0教程 詳解EJB技術及實現原理
tee nsa 普通 事情 println 配置 ransac 教程 聲明 EJB是什麽呢?EJB是一個J2EE體系中的組件.再簡單的說它是一個能夠遠程調用的javaBean.它同普通的javaBean有兩點不同.第一點,就是遠程調用.第二點,就是事務的功能,我們在EJB中
【2018中國計算機大會】阿里雲高階總監談超大規模超高效能分散式快儲存系統
新型硬體(如NVRAM、RDMA、GPU/TPU等)及其構建的異構複雜環境,與既有硬體環境的巨大差異,導致傳統的演算法、資料結構甚至是涉及原則和經驗法則等難以為繼,對計算智慧與大資料處理帶來新的挑戰和機遇。 10月27日下午,2018中國計算機大會上舉辦了主題“新型硬體環境下大資料處理技術”的技術論壇,一起
下一代雲端儲存系統技術白皮書(關於儲存的一些好文轉載--3)
1 下一代雲端儲存系統簡介 1.1雲端儲存系統簡介 資訊處理技術、網際網路技術、雲端計算技術的誕生與成長對各行各業產生著潛移默化的影響。網際網路時代,資料採集手段紛繁複雜,形態五花八門,半結構化與非結構化資料體量日趨增大,傳統的儲架構已經逐漸顯現出自身的固有侷限。 在傳統資料中心中,以
文獻筆記03-基於異構資料來源的網路等級考試報名管理系統設計及實現
一、基本資訊 標題:基於異構資料來源的網路等級考試報名管理系統設計及實現 時間:2008. 出版源:中國知網 領域分類:計算機應用及軟體 二、研究背景 隨著我國高校擴大招生工作的進行,高校對學生的等級考試管理工作也面臨著新的要求。全國大學英語四、六級考試,專業外語四、八級考試,計算機等級考試,普通
阿里雲高階總監談超大規模超高效能分散式快儲存系統
摘要: 10月27日下午,2018中國計算機大會上舉辦了主題“新型硬體環境下大資料處理技術”的技術論壇,一起探討新型硬體帶來的變化。論壇上,阿里雲高階總監馬濤針對超大規模超高效能分散式塊儲存系統ESSD進行了報告分析。 新型硬體(如NVRAM、RDMA、GPU/TPU等)及其構建的異構複雜環境,與既有硬體環
分散式鎖之redis鎖及實現
分散式鎖有幾種常用的實現方式:zookeeper、memcached、redis、mysql。這裡介紹一下redis的實現方式,並在最後附上了一個Demo小工具: 眾所周知,reids鎖是通過setnx + expire的方式實現的,setnx保證只有在key不存在時才能se
Java架構-蘇寧 11.11:蘇寧易購訂單搜尋系統架構及實現
背景 隨著蘇寧易購平臺規模的飛速發展,平臺的訂單量呈現指數級的增長,儲存容量已達 TB 級,訂單量更是到了萬億級別,尤其在雙 11 大促流量洪峰的場景下,面臨兩個挑戰: 1、如何儲存如此巨大的資料量 2、如何提供高併發、低延遲、多維度的檢索服務 傳統關係型資料庫無法支撐多維度的